According to the National Weather Service forecasts for our area, precautions should be taken as travel conditions may be very dangerous. A Winter Storm Warning and Winter Weather Advisories have been issued. A rapidly evolving winter weather event is unfolding this afternoon as temperatures over South Central Texas have dropped dramatically. Periods of freezing drizzle and light freezing rain are expected, prompting the need for Winter Storm Warnings, Winter Weather Advisories, and an expanded area of communities impacted. Significant ice accumulation impacts are now considered likely over the Hill Country and Central Texas. This will make travel conditions very dangerous. All roads, elevated surfaces and walkways could have ice accumulations from today through noon on Wednesday.

City crews are currently preparing for possible icing of our streets and will apply de-icing salt when appropriate. All emergency services and utilities are prepared and ready to support the community.
Additional information will be provided by the City as this event develops.
